A Creative Spark with a Purposeful Start
Roli’s professional path began at the prestigious National Institute of Fashion Technology (NIFT), Mumbai, where she graduated in 2010. With a background in fashion design, she entered the world of merchandising and styling—roles that refined her eye for detail, aesthetics, and storytelling. But it wasn’t long before she discovered a deeper calling: connecting with people, especially women, through digital platforms.
Her first foray into content creation was in 2012 with Crazy Indian Wedding, one of India’s earliest and most-loved wedding blogs. What began as a personal outlet evolved into a go-to platform for brides-to-be. Her relatable voice and helpful insights caught the eye of mainstream media, with features in Femina Brides, Cosmopolitan, and Hindustan Times.

From Sarees to Screens: A Digital Evolution
In 2013, she launched her own fashion label, introducing quirky sarees that resonated with young, modern women. With no big marketing budget, she turned to the most powerful (and underused at the time) tool—social media.
Roli leveraged Instagram and Facebook to showcase her brand story, reaching audiences in India and beyond. This wasn’t just a success in sales—it was a masterclass in digital visibility, brand building, and authentic community engagement.
The Mommy Vlogger in India
Roli’s digital journey took an exciting turn in 2014 when she launched her YouTube channel as a comedy creator, experimenting with sketches and relatable content. But everything changed in 2015, when she stepped into motherhood—a chapter that deeply transformed her purpose and platform.
She pivoted her channel to focus on mommy vlogging, becoming one of India’s first mom and baby content creators. Through her channel RGV Love, Roli began sharing real stories of pregnancy, parenting, and everyday life as a new mom.
Her honest voice, heartfelt experiences, and ability to connect emotionally with her audience turned the channel into more than just content—it became a virtual village of support for young Indian mothers. Today, the channel has crossed 21 million views, inspiring thousands of women who see their own journey reflected in hers.
The Birth of Social Maata
With a decade of experience as a content creator and strategist, Roli saw a gap: countless women-led businesses were building powerful products but struggling to communicate their value online.
In 2023, she founded Social Maata, a digital marketing agency with a mission to empower women entrepreneurs through personalized social media strategy, content creation, influencer collaborations, and performance-focused campaigns.
Under her leadership, Social Maata drove 14 million+ views for its clients within a year and was honored with the MSME Best Startup of the Year 2024 (Marketing). Roli herself received the Most Influential Mom Blogger award, affirming her role as both innovator and mentor.
